POSITION PROFILE The sommelier is passionate, knowledgeable, and service-driven. This person will elevate the guest experience at our fine dining restaurant. The ideal candidate brings deep appreciation for both Old World and New World wines, strong sales acumen, and a confident yet gracious presence on the floor. This role is guest-facing, education-focused, and performance-driven, with commission-based earning potential tied directly to wine sales.

Responsibilities

  • Curate, maintain, and present the wine program with excellence and attention to detail
  • Provide thoughtful wine recommendations tailored to guest preferences, menu selections, and budget
  • Actively drive wine sales through confident, polished, and authentic tableside engagement
  • Educate guests and staff on wine regions, varietals, vintages, and pairings
  • Maintain a visible, professional, and welcoming presence on the dining room floor
  • Collaborate with the culinary and management teams on pairings, menu updates, and special events
  • Ensure proper storage, handling, and service of all wines
  • Uphold the highest standards of hospitality, professionalism, and brand representation
  • Meet and conduct wine tastings with vendors, seasonally update wine lists and assist management with ordering of the product
